Flat Roofs
Flat roofings are a terrific method to keep a structure safe from water. Knowing exactly what to do with a flat roofing system will guarantee you have a working roof system that will last a very long time.
might look excellent, and are extremely typical, flat roofs do need regular maintenance and in-depth repair work in order to effectively avoid water seepage. properly, you'll enjoy with your flat roofing for a long time.
Flat roofing systems aren't as glamorous and/or popular as its newer equivalents, such as tile, copper, or slate roofing systems. They are just as crucial and require even more attention. In order to prevent getting rid of cash on short-term repair work, you must understand exactly how flat roof systems are developed, the numerous types of flat roofings that are readily available, and the significance of routine inspection and upkeep.
A flat roof system works by supplying a water resistant membrane over a structure. It consists of several layers of hydrophobic materials that is put over a structural deck with a vapor barrier that is normally positioned between roof membrane.
Flashing, or thin strips of material such as copper, converge with the membrane and the other structure elements to prevent water infiltration. The water is then directed to drains, downspouts, and seamless gutters by the roofing system's minor pitch.
There are 4 most common kinds of flat roofing system systems. Noted in order of increasing sturdiness and expense, they are: roll asphalt, single-ply membrane, multiple-ply or built-up, and flat-seamed metal. They can range anywhere from as low as $2 per square foot for roll asphalt or single-ply roof that is applied over and existing roofing system, to $20 per square foot or more for new metal roofs.
Used since the 1890s, asphalt roll roofing generally consists of one layer of asphalt-saturated natural or fiberglass base felts that are applied over roofing system felt with nails and cold asphalt cement and usually covered with a granular mineral surface area. The joints are usually covered over with a roofing compound. It can last about 10 years.
Single-ply membrane roofing is the latest type of roofing material. It is often utilized to change multiple-ply roofings. 10 to 12 year service warranties are typical, however appropriate installation is vital and maintenance is still required.
Multiple-ply or built-up roofing, also referred to as BUR, is made of overlapping rolls of saturated or layered felts or mats that are sprinkled with layers of bitumen and emerged with a granular roof sheet, tile, or ballast pavers that are utilized to secure the hidden products from the weather. BURs are designed to last 10 to 30 years, which depends upon the products utilized.
Ballast, or aggregate, of crushed stone or water-worn gravel is embedded in a coating of asphalt or coal tar. Since the ballast or tile pavers cover the membrane, it makes examining and preserving the seams of the roofing system difficult.
Flat-seamed roofs have been used since the 19 th century. Made from small pieces of sheet metal soldered flush at the joints, it can last many years depending upon the quality of the direct exposure, material, and upkeep to the components.
Galvanized metal does require regular painting in order to prevent corrosion and split seams require to be resoldered. Other metal surfaces, such as copper, can end up being pitted and pinholed from acid raid and typically needs changing. Today copper, lead-coated copper, and terne-coated stainless steel are preferred as lasting flat roofings.
